Sports minister, CM’s aide review construction work at Arbab Niaz Stadium

PESHAWAR, Feb 12 (APP):Khyber Pakhtunkhwa Minister for Sports and Youth Affairs, Syed Fakhar Jehan, Advisor for Finanace Muzammil Aslam and  Special Assistant to the Chief Minister of Khyber Pakhtunkhwa for Communication & Works Sohail Afridi on Wednesday  visited the Arbab Niaz Stadium in Peshawar and reviewed the ongoing construction work.
Secretary of Sports and Youth Affairs, Muhammad Zia ul Haq, Secretary of Communications and Works Department, Dr. Muhammad Israr along with Additional Secretary of Sports Pir Abdullah Shah, Director General of Sports Abdul Nasir Khan and other senior officials from the department as well as the Superintendent Engineer, Executive Engineer  and other staff from the Department of C&W, consultants for the stadium construction project and relevant contractors were also present during the visit.
The provincial minister and other government representatives were briefed about the remaining work in the final phase of the stadium’s construction.
The Executive Engineer from C&W provided details about the completed work and progress toward finalizing the project.
During the visit, Fakhar Jehan stated that the construction work on the Arbab Niaz Stadium is nearing completion and is in its final stages.He instructed that to expedite the remaining work for the timely handover of the stadium, work should continue in three shifts while progress in this regard should be reviewed on a daily basis.
He also mentioned that soon PSL matches will be held at this stadium and the people will also soon be able to witness international cricket here.
Advisor for Finance Muzammil Aslam said that the Arbab Niaz Stadium is an important ground for cricket in the province and there will be no issue from the government’s side in ensuring the swift completion and handover of the project.
He added that this stadium would meet high standards and accommodate a large number of spectators. The local people will soon be able to watch their national players playing in this stadium.
Special Assistant for C&W, Sohail Afridi instructed the officials of C&W Department to expedite the necessary steps to ensure the timely completion and handover of the project, so that to avoid any further delays.
